SANTA MARIA, Calif. – The Santa Maria Police Department reached out to the public for help and eventually located a missing elderly man who was considered at-risk.
According to the Santa Maria Police Department, the missing 90-year-old was found in the city Sunday and was safely reunited with his family.
“The Santa Maria Police Department would like to thank the community for its continued vigilance and support in cases like this,” stated a press release Monday about the successful search. “We rely on our strong partnership with the public to serve as an extension of our eyes and ears in the community.”
